Dog Deafness Condition Symptoms and Treatments


Deafness, a partial or complete loss of hearing ability is a condition most seen in dog breeds like German Shepherds, Cocker Spaniels, Old English Sheepdogs and Dalmatians.

These dog breeds are more prone to getting the deafness condition as they grow old. Nevertheless, deafness in dogs can affect any dog breed.

Symptoms
The first symptom of deafness in your dog is that he fails to response to your call and verbal command. He may also appear to sleep very soundly when there is a large commotion in the house.

It might not be the easiest thing to detect your dog deafness condition because many dogs seem to know that they cannot hear properly and compensate by looking at their owners more closely and attentively.

If you suspect deafness in your dog, try to test him when your dog back is against you. If he fail to response, he most probably have deafness problem.

Treatment
There are many different causes to deafness in dogs. It may be cause by a physical blockage within the ear canal, either by swelling or foreign objects. Tumors, also known as polyps or the dog’s ear drum itself may have been hurt.

The cost of treatment in dog deafness depends on the underlying problem of the condition and might cost a lot more than you have expected.

The dilemma of keeping a deaf dog is that most people feel that it’s highly unlikely for the dog to live a fulfilling life. Therefore most people choose the option to put their dog to sleep.
